Tasting Notes
Robert Parker – 91
Cathiard’s 2020 Chambolle Musigny Clos de l’Orme mingles aromas of raspberries and plums with hints of burning embers, warm spices, rose petals and loamy soil. Medium to full-bodied, lively and concentrated, its rich core of fruit is framed by powdery tannins.
Vinous – 89
The 2020 Chambolle-Musigny Les Clos de l’Orme is one cuvee where I felt there was a little sur-maturite with touches of fig and dates infusing the red fruit. The palate is succulent and very ripe, though the acidity maintains the freshness. Quite dense towards the finish, I would just like to see a little more terroir expression here.
Anticipated maturity: 2024-2030
